Comprehensive On-Premises Disaster Recovery Planning and Implementation
A robust resilience strategy is paramount for any organization reliant on its on-premises infrastructure. Developing a comprehensive disaster recovery plan involves assessing critical systems, data, and dependencies. Fundamental steps include establishing clear restoration objectives, architecting redundant infrastructure, and conducting regular drills to test the plan's effectiveness. A well-defined disaster recovery plan ensures minimal downtime, data loss, and operational impact in the event of a catastrophic incident.
Implementing the disaster recovery plan requires meticulous documentation. This includes establishing clear responsibilities for different scenarios, securing critical data and assets, and maintaining a thorough inventory of hardware and software. Regular evaluation and updates are essential to ensure the plan remains current in an ever-changing threat landscape.
- Regularly review and update your disaster recovery plan to reflect changes in your environment.
- Guarantee all personnel involved are trained on their roles and responsibilities during a disaster.
- Validate your disaster recovery plan through regular simulations to identify gaps and refine procedures.

Disaster Recovery as a Service: A Secure Solution for Modern Businesses
In today's volatile business landscape, safeguarding against disruptions is paramount. Security threats and natural disasters can cripple operations, leading to significant financial losses Backup and Disaster Recovery Solutions and reputational damage. That's where Disaster Recovery as a Service (DRaaS) steps in, providing a robust and secure solution to minimize downtime and ensure business continuity.
DRaaS empowers businesses of all sizes to implement a comprehensive disaster recovery plan without the need for hefty upfront investments or specialized IT expertise. By outsourcing cloud-based infrastructure, companies can access a range of services, including data backup, virtual machine provisioning, and failover capabilities.
This adaptable approach allows businesses to rapidly recover from disasters and resume operations with minimal disruption. With DRaaS, you can reduce the impact of unforeseen events and maintain your competitive edge in today's demanding market.
